There was in fact a conspiracy theory at the time that slaveowners infiltrated the White House staff (DC being in the South) and had Zachary Taylor poisoned Not because ZT was an abolitionist - he was, in fact, a slaveowner - but he was a "moderate" against expanding slaveryhttps://twitter.com/baddestmamajama/status/1236000599780388864 …

It's not the kind of thing I'd put last them - Lincoln was slightly less "moderately" against slavery and their response to him was plunging the nation into war and then shooting him when they lost But it seems unlikely, they had his corpse tested for arsenic and everything

Anyway he got his fatal chronic diarrhea from eating cherries *in milk* In an era before pasteurization and modern refrigeration, in notoriously hot, muggy DC, at a time when much of the city was an open sewer (Yes, I know, "you mean right now?", ha ha)

So a nefarious explanation probably isn't actually necessary, since there was in fact a "stomach bug" that went around the city at the time and hit a lot of his colleagues too and he was just unlucky
